PCIOA drives industry alignment on AI, finance, and data sovereignty agenda

The Philippine Chief Information Officers Association (PCIOA) has driven stronger alignment among business and technology leaders on artificial intelligence, financial innovation, and data sovereignty, as organizations move to adopt more coordinated and responsible approaches to digital transformation.

The push emerged from discussions during PCIOA’s General Membership Meeting, where industry executives underscored the need to connect technology adoption with trust, governance, and long-term sustainability rather than treating innovation as an isolated goal.

PCIOA Chairperson and Chief Executive Mel Migriño said the discussions highlighted the need for organizations to move beyond simply adopting emerging technologies and instead focus on building resilient and values-driven leadership.

“As technology and business executives, we often talk about digital transformation, Gen AI, and blockchain as if these are the destinations we are heading toward. But as leaders in this room know, transformation and these emerging technologies are not the only imperatives when we reach the finish line—they are part of our so-called permanent environment,” Migriño said.

“We are leading in an era where the only thing moving faster than the pace of technology is the rate of uncertainty,” she added.

According to PCIOA, the gathering resulted in stronger alignment among industry leaders on the importance of balancing innovation with accountability, particularly as businesses accelerate AI adoption and digital finance initiatives.

“Navigating uncertainty requires two things that may seem like opposites but are, in fact, partners: agility and integrity,” Migriño said.

“Agility allows us to pivot strategies, embrace AI, and re-engineer our businesses in real time. Integrity—one of PCIOA’s core values—serves as our anchor, ensuring that while our tactics evolve, our principles remain non-negotiable,” she added.

The PCIOA is a non-profit organization supporting the Digital ASEAN initiative and serves as a community of technology leaders and practitioners advancing digital transformation, cybersecurity, data privacy, and AI governance in the Philippines.

PCIOA is the Philippines’ exclusive country affiliate of the ASEAN CXO Association, headquartered in Singapore.

With the theme “Where the Future of Finance Meets Data Sovereignty,” the event also featured discussions from Revolut Philippines CEO Designate Albert Tinio, who shared insights on the future of finance and the increasing role of trust and data governance in digital banking ecosystems.

“The future of finance is no longer about brick and mortar, but about building borderless, invisible infrastructure that turns global volatility into local resilience. We must pivot from managing legacy systems to architecting the digital rails that ensure the Philippines remains unshakeable in an unpredictable world,” Tinio said.

Industry leaders at the event emphasized that financial innovation can no longer be separated from discussions on data sovereignty, cybersecurity, and consumer confidence as digital transactions continue to expand.

Meanwhile, Mansmith CEO Chiqui Escareal-Go highlighted the need to humanize technology adoption, stressing that digital transformation efforts must remain centered on people and organizational culture rather than technology alone.

“The right thing to ask isn’t just what does this system do — it’s what does it feel like to be inside it. Are we solving the problem — or are we truly serving the person?” Escareal-Go said.

PCIOA pointed out that the event further strengthened collaboration between business and technology leaders from various sectors, while encouraging organizations to adopt more responsible and resilient approaches to innovation amid evolving digital risks.

“In uncertain times, we can no longer rely on a fixed roadmap—we must follow a compass. And you, the technology and business leaders of this country, are that compass,” Migriño said.

The organization noted that the gathering forms part of its continuing efforts to help enterprises navigate emerging technologies while promoting responsible leadership, trust, and long-term digital sustainability in the Philippines’ evolving digital economy.
